Exploring the Best Materials for Your Sex Doll Customization

When it comes to sex doll customization, one of the most important decisions you’ll make is selecting the right material. The material affects not only the doll’s feel but also its appearance, durability, and maintenance requirements. Understanding the pros and cons of different materials will help you choose the best option for your preferences.

TPE (Thermoplastic Elastomer) is one of the most common materials used for sex dolls. TPE is soft, flexible, and highly realistic, closely resembling the feel of human skin. It has a smooth texture and is ideal for those seeking a lifelike tactile experience. However, TPE requires more maintenance as it’s more prone to staining and needs regular cleaning and care.

Silicone is another popular option known for its durability and ease of cleaning. Silicone dolls are firmer and less flexible than TPE dolls, but they offer a longer lifespan and are more resistant to damage. Silicone also has a slightly more rigid feel compared to TPE, but it still provides a lifelike experience. It’s the preferred choice for people who want a low-maintenance option that will last longer.

Some dolls may combine both materials, offering the best of both worlds. Silicone heads with TPE bodies are common, providing a balance between realism and durability.

By understanding the advantages and disadvantages of each material, you can select the one that best fits your needs and preferences.
